Gravity and magnetics
Modeling, inversion, and processing for potential field methods.
3D forward modeling with prisms,
polygonal prisms, spheres, and tesseroids.
Handles the potential, acceleration,
gradient tensor, magnetic induction, total field magnetic anomaly.
